**Ticket PARITY-412: Kestrel SDK catch-up**

Quick one for the weekly sync: the Kestrel-Go SDK is still missing batched uploads and retry hints that Kestrel-JS shipped two releases ago. Partner teams keep asking. Plan is to land both behind a flag this sprint and cut a minor release. Needs a sign-off from the owner named below.

account owner for bajef-badup: Drueth Kelath Pelael Holwyn

## Releases

BounceHerd releases are cut from the main branch after the suppression-list tests pass. Each release artifact is signed before it reaches the Quill package mirror, and consumers verify signatures at install. Reviewers should confirm the tag, changelog, and signature all match. Verify release signatures against the public key below.

rollout seal: bky9_PeXH1fTLY

## Sweeper v4.2 — Changed Defaults

Heads up, support folks: the Tidewater retention sweeper now runs nightly instead of weekly, and the grace window for soft-deleted records dropped from 90 to 30 days. Customers on legacy plans keep the old window automatically. Expect a few tickets about "missing" archives the first week — point people at the restore tool. The new default configuration ships as follows.

deployment values, kajep-kageg:
[praix]
host = praix.paliqcorp.corp
user = praix_svc
database = praix_prod

## Step 4: Point the plugin registry at Hermeton

Once your plugin builds under Hermeton's sealed toolchain, remove any references to ambient environment variables — the sandbox strips them. Declare every fetch in your manifest instead. Finally, register your plugin's build fingerprint so the Veldrome registry can verify reproducibility. The registration tool stores fingerprints in the shared catalog, which it reaches via the connection string below.

primary connection of tajeg-tajop = postgresql://julax_svc:DI@db-e7f3.kelvidyn.corp:5432/rusdor